The Gibson Marauder models were made between 1974 til 1979 and it was Gibsons attempt to break into the Fender dominated "bolt-on" / single-coil market, though in fact Marauders had two humbucking pickups (developed by Bill Lawrence). The body is a contoured Les Paul-shaped solid-body made of mahogany and the bolt-on neck was made of maple with a rosewood fretboard. The headstock was similar to the headstock of a Flying V.
